Jim Porter <jporterbugs@gmail.com> writes:
> On the other hand, the way bindings work in 'if-let*' and 'when-let*'
> are closer to 'let*' than 'let'. I think that's a false friend though,
> since they're only similar, not actually the same (of course the
> semantics couldn't be exactly the same or there'd be no reason for
> 'if-let*' and 'when-let*' to exist).
FWIW, this is the argument that convinced me that the `*`-versions are
better: bindings are more like in `let` than in `let*`. To my mind,
that makes the `*`-naming more self-documenting and clear.
